According to the National Center for Hydro-Meteorological Forecasting, cold air is strengthening and moving south.

This evening and tonight (January 27), this cold air mass will affect the Northeast region, then the Northwest, North Central and some places in the Central Central region. Northeast winds inland will gradually strengthen to level 2-3, coastal areas level 4, gusting to level 5-6.

Due to the influence of cold air, the North and Thanh Hoa continue to experience severe cold; Nghe An and Ha Tinh areas are severely cold; from Quang Binh to Thua Thien Hue it is cold.

During this cold air mass, the lowest temperature in the North and Thanh Hoa is generally from 8-11 degrees, in the mountainous areas of the North from 4-7 degrees, in the high mountainous areas below 3 degrees in some places; Nghe An and Ha Tinh from 11-13 degrees; Quang Binh to Thua Thien Hue from 13-16 degrees.

The North is experiencing drizzly, cold days; forecast to continue until around January 29. From January 30, sunshine will return. Illustration: Hoang Ha

However, this cold spell quickly ended when the sun began to appear again on January 30, causing the temperature across the region to increase sharply, to 20 degrees. After that, it was only cold at night and in the morning; daytime temperatures could reach 24-25 degrees, with sunshine.

Meteorological experts predict that in the days before and during the 2024 Lunar New Year, there will be another cold spell, but it is not forecast to be as strong as the current one.
